Yancheng Outdoor Skiing: A Surprising Winter Escape (Exploring Alternatives & Future Potential)368
Yancheng, a coastal city in Jiangsu Province, China, isn't typically associated with skiing. The image conjured up is more likely one of sprawling salt marshes, abundant birdlife, and the gentle sea breeze. The thought of finding outdoor skiing opportunities in such a region might seem ludicrous, yet the concept itself presents a fascinating challenge and an intriguing exploration of possibility. This discussion delves into the current realities, potential future developments, and alternative outdoor winter activities readily available in and around Yancheng for the adventurous spirit.
Currently, there are no established outdoor ski resorts or slopes in Yancheng or its immediate vicinity. The climate simply doesn't lend itself to the consistent snowfall necessary to maintain a natural skiing environment. The winters are mild and relatively short, with snowfall infrequent and often insufficient for creating skiable conditions. Unlike northern China, where substantial mountain ranges offer ample opportunities for ski resorts, Yancheng's flat coastal landscape presents a significant obstacle.

Future Potential for Outdoor Skiing in Yancheng: While the likelihood of natural snow-based skiing remains low, technological advancements might one day offer alternative solutions. Artificial snow-making technologies are constantly improving, potentially making it feasible to create smaller, controlled skiing areas, even in regions with limited snowfall. However, this would require significant investment and would likely only be a viable option if there is sufficient local demand and support.
Furthermore, the development of eco-friendly and sustainable artificial snow systems would be crucial to ensure environmental responsibility, given Yancheng’s delicate ecological balance. Such a project would need careful consideration of its impact on water resources and energy consumption.
